Vardenafil hydrochloride tablets are not indicated for use in pediatric patients. Safety and efficacy have not been established in this population. Elderly males 65 years of age and older have higher vardenafil plasma concentrations than younger males (18 – 45 years), mean C max and AUC were 34% and 52% higher, respectively. However, due to increased vardenafil concentrations in the elderly, a starting dose of 5 mg vardenafil hydrochloride tablets should be considered in patients ≥65 years of age [see Clinical Pharmacology (12.3)]. Dosage adjustment is necessary in patients with moderate hepatic impairment.

Vardenafil hydrochloride tablets are formulated as orange, round, tablets embossed with "2.5", "5", "10" or "20" on one side corresponding to 2.5 mg, 5 mg, 10 mg, and 20 mg of vardenafil, respectively. 12 CLINICAL PHARMACOLOGY 12.1 Mechanism of ActionPenile erection is a hemodynamic process initiated by the relaxation of smooth muscle in the corpus cavernosum and its associated arterioles. During sexual stimulation, nitric oxide is released from nerve endings and endothelial cells in the corpus cavernosum. Nitric oxide activates the enzyme guanylate cyclase resulting in increased synthesis of cyclic guanosine monophosphate (cGMP) in the smooth muscle cells of the corpus cavernosum. The cGMP in turn triggers smooth muscle relaxation, allowing increased blood flow into the penis, resulting in erection. The tissue concentration of cGMP is regulated by both the rates of synthesis and degradation via phosphodiesterases (PDEs). The most abundant PDE in the human corpus cavernosum is the cGMP-specific phosphodiesterase type 5 (PDE5); therefore, the inhibition of PDE5 enhances erectile function by increasing the amount of cGMP. Because sexual stimulation is required to initiate the local release of nitric oxide, the inhibition of PDE5 has no effect in the absence of sexual stimulation.In vitro studies have shown that vardenafil is a selective inhibitor of PDE5. The inhibitory effect of vardenafil is more selective on PDE5 than for other known phosphodiesterases (>15-fold relative to PDE6, >130-fold relative to PDE1, >300-fold relative to PDE11, and >1,000-fold relative to PDE2, 3, 4, 7, 8, 9, and 10).12.2 PharmacodynamicsEffects on Blood PressureIn a clinical pharmacology study of patients with erectile dysfunction, single doses of vardenafil 20 mg caused a mean maximum decrease in supine blood pressure of 7 mmHg systolic and 8 mmHg diastolic (compared to placebo), accompanied by a mean maximum increase of heart rate of 4 beats per minute. No dosage adjustment is necessary in patients with mild hepatic impairment.8.7 Renal ImpairmentDo not use vardenafil hydrochloride tablets in patients on renal dialysis as vardenafil has not been evaluated in such patients.No dosage adjustment is necessary in patients with creatinine clearance (CLcr) of 30–80 mL/min. In male volunteers with CLcr = 50-80 ml/min, the pharmacokinetics of vardenafil were similar to those observed in a control group with CLcr >80 mL/min. In male volunteers with CLcr = 30-50 mL/min or CLcr <30 mL/min, the AUC of vardenafil was 20–30% higher compared to that observed in a control group with CLcr >80 mL/min. [See Dosage and Administration (2.3) and Warnings and Precautions (5.9).] 10 OVERDOSAGE The maximum dose of vardenafil hydrochloride tablets for which human data are available is a single 120 mg dose administered to healthy male volunteers. The majority of these subjects experienced reversible back pain/myalgia and/or "abnormal vision." Single doses up to 80 mg vardenafil and multiple doses up to 40 mg vardenafil administered once daily over 4 weeks were tolerated without producing serious adverse side effects.When 40 mg of vardenafil was administered twice daily, cases of severe back pain were observed. No muscle or neurological toxicity was identified.In cases of overdose, standard supportive measures should be taken as required.
Professional resources
Renal dialysis is not expected to accelerate clearance as vardenafil is highly bound to plasma proteins and not significantly eliminated in the urine.
